Paraffin embedding is a well-developed method that is widely used as a basic tool for histomorphology. Compared to other methods, embedding shows good morphological preservation, and sectioning properties (Onodera et al., 1992), but unfortunately quenches fluorescent proteins.This results in a poor fluorescent signal …

WebThe fixative used is influenced by the target antigen as well as the desired detection technique ( fluorescent or chromogenic ). The tissue sample is then either embedded in paraffin or frozen. Embedding is important in preserving tissue morphology and giving the tissue support during sectioning. WebJan 10, 2024 · Here, ultrathin sections of organ preparations (usually embedded in paraffin wax) are used to e.g. investigate the expression of proteins in a healthy organ compared to a diseased one. In addition to the preparation of tissue sections it is also possible to perform IF with whole organisms, a process referred to as "whole mount IHC".
